Chevron announces US$15 billion capital and exploratory budget for 2022

In the company's upstream business, approximately US$8 billion is allocated to currently producing assets, including about US$3 billion for Permian Basin unconventional development and approximately US$1.5 billion for other shale and tight assets worldwide.

 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 

ADNOC awards US$6 billion in drilling contracts

Schlumberger, Weatherford and Baker Hughes were among the companies to receive contracts for wellheads and related components, downhole completion equipment and related services, and liner hangers and cementing accessories.

 
 

GlobalData: US upstream Lower 48 M&A deals on the rise

In its latest report, ‘Key Upstream M&A Deals in 2021’, the data and analytics company reveals that the total number of deals in the US upstream sector grew from 388 in 2020 to 420 in 2021.
